The Lapu-Lapu City Government has launched a scholarship program that will provide financial assistance to qualified Oponganon students pursuing college education in state universities and colleges.
The Lapu-Lapu City Scholarship Program for Higher Education (LLC-SPHE) is being implemented through the Local Youth Development Office (LYDO) under amended Ordinance No. 17-062-2026.
The ordinance renamed the previous Lapu-Lapu City Educational Assistance for Higher Education Program and established the guidelines for the new scholarship initiative.
The city government said the program will be managed by a scholarship committee chaired by Mayor Ma. Cynthia “Cindi” King-Chan.
SK Federation President Orlan Joseph Carungay serves as vice chairperson, while City Councilor Annabeth Cuizon, chairperson of the City Council committee on education, is a member of the committee.
The city said 18 applicants have already undergone interviews as part of the initial screening process for the scholarship program.
Applicants will be evaluated based on both merit and financial need, with criteria including academic performance, face-to-face interview results, socio-economic status, and priority degree programs.
To apply, students must submit an accomplished application form, school records, certificate of enrollment, certified copy of their course prospectus, and proof that their parents’ or legal guardians’ annual gross income does not exceed P250,000.
Applicants may also submit alternative documents, such as a Bureau of Internal Revenue tax exemption certificate or an affidavit of no or low income, if they are unable to provide an income tax return.
The scholarship is open to qualified Oponganon students enrolled in state universities and colleges, subject to the requirements and guidelines set by the Local Youth Development Office.
The city government said the program aims to provide educational support to deserving students and help qualified residents continue their higher education.
